ESA says Rosetta in good shape after 31-month snooze2/1/14
'..The verdict: Rosetta is healthy and ready for its high-stakes approach to comet Churyumov-Gerasimenko. In August, the $1.7 billion mission will arrive in the icy world's neighborhood, becoming the first spacecraft to enter orbit around a comet.' 'In November, Rosetta will eject a small German-built lander to latch on to the comet to collect panoramic imagery and drill into its mysterious surface -- another first in space exploration.' International Rosetta team includes a contribution from Finnish space technology companies Patria (www.patria.fi), FMI (Space, http://en.ilmatieteenlaitos.fi/space) and AL Safety Design Ltd. - Product Assurance, www.alsafety.com) |
